Points of Interest Types
The map features twenty distinct types of interactive elements, each serving specific gameplay functions from healing and mobility to resource management and tactical positioning.
Campfires
Stationary healing stations that restore health over time when activated. These provide crucial mid-game healing without consuming inventory space, making them valuable for extended engagements.
IO Launch Pad
High-tech launch pads that catapult players across significant distances. These offer quick escape routes or aggressive positioning opportunities during intense combat situations.
Large Bush
Oversized vegetation that provides temporary concealment and camouflage. Players can hide inside these bushes to avoid detection or set up ambush positions.
Mending Machines
Automated repair stations that restore shield points in exchange for materials. These machines offer reliable shield restoration when other healing items are scarce.
Reboot Vans
Revival stations that allow teammates to bring back eliminated squad members. These provide second chances in team-based modes and are crucial for maintaining squad strength.
Slurp Barrels
Destructible containers filled with healing liquid that restores both health and shield. Breaking these barrels creates puddles that provide ongoing healing effects.
Slurp Tanker
Large industrial containers holding substantial amounts of healing slurp. These offer more healing potential than regular barrels and can supply entire squads.
Vending Machines
Automated vendors that exchange materials for weapons and items. These machines provide access to specific gear without relying on random loot spawns.
Vehicles
Various transportation options including cars, boats, and aircraft. These provide rapid map traversal and can serve as mobile cover during firefights.
Slurp Pool
Natural pools of healing liquid that gradually restore health and shield. These offer sustained healing for teams willing to spend time in one location.

FAQs
Do Points of Interest respawn during matches?
Most Points of Interest are static throughout the match, but consumable elements like Slurp Barrels and some vending machine items may be depleted once used. Vehicles can be destroyed but may respawn in certain game modes.
Can enemies use the same Points of Interest?
Yes, all Points of Interest are accessible to any player. This creates strategic decisions about timing and positioning, as using healing stations or mobility devices can expose you to enemy attacks.
Which Points of Interest are most important for new players?
New players should prioritize Campfires for healing, Vehicles for mobility, and Vending Machines for reliable weapon access. These provide essential survival tools while learning the game’s mechanics.
Do Points of Interest change between seasons?
Yes, Fortnite regularly updates Points of Interest locations and types with each new season. New interactive elements are added while others may be removed or relocated as the map evolves.
